HTCM-A5——HTCM-A30

The HTCM series masterbatch dosing machine is suitable for the automatic blending of raw materials, recycled materials, masterbatches, or additives. This product uses a stepper motor with speeds ranging from 0 to 200 RPM and offers five different models—A5, A10, A15, A20, and A30—with screw types that provide production capacities ranging from 0.2 to 50 kg/hour for customers to choose from.


Features
  • Standard voltage: single-phase 220V, 50Hz/60Hz;
  • The screw is made of precision-cast stainless steel, making it durable.
  • The modular assembly structure simplifies installation, disassembly, cleaning, and part replacement;
  • It can also meet the requirements for external signal input;
  • It features a forced material cleaning function, facilitating the change of the color masterbatch;
  • It is suitable for extruders, requiring only minor wiring modifications;
  • RPM can automatically adjust its speed based on the extruder speed to maintain a constant masterbatch ratio;
  • A set of 50 parameter formulas where discharge time and final product weight are permanently recorded;
  • The use of a stepper motor ensures precision and stability;
  • Standard RS458 communication function.

HTGB-1-2——HTGB-25-4

The HTGB series of weighing machines is suitable for the precise blending of various raw materials based on their weight ratios. The control unit of this series utilizes an imported control system and an adaptive algorithm, and features automatic repeated calibration to ensure accuracy. It is easy to use and learn. This series uses a high-precision AD conversion module to control batch mixing ratio error (depending on the set ratio) within the range of ±0.1% to 0.5%. The appropriate model can be selected based on the type and quantity of raw material to be processed and hourly consumption; it has a maximum processing capacity of 3,000 kg per hour.


Features
  • All materials are weighed using the gravity method and then mixed homogeneously; this ensures strict control of accuracy.
  • Advanced dosing technology ensures precise control and measurement of the ratios of each raw material being processed;
  • The automatic repeat calibration function will automatically adjust and calibrate after each weighing to ensure optimal batch accuracy.
  • It can process up to 7 different raw materials simultaneously;
  • Modular and removable structural design for easy cleaning;
  • This device features a recipe storage function capable of storing up to 40 recipes;
  • It has a function to record alarm history;
  • The HTGB-5 and earlier systems are standardly equipped with machine mounting (including a standard base and manual shut-off plate);
  • For the HTGB-10 and higher systems, the standard configuration is a three-legged stand-mounted type (equipped with a three-legged stand, storage tank, discharge valve, and suction box).
  • By adding an optional USB data export function, mixing ratio data can be recorded and retained to facilitate production quality management;
  • An optional RS485 communication interface can communicate with a host computer to provide centralized monitoring;
  • Optional products: 1. Stand, 2. GB standard with vacuum feeder.

HTHS-50—HTHS-200

The HTHS series vertical mixer is designed for mixing granular materials. It stands out for its simple design, ease of use, practical maintenance and cleaning, high speed, and excellent mixing performance. While primarily used for mixing plastic granules, it is also widely applicable in industries such as plastics, metallurgy, and ceramics, making it an ideal mixing equipment.


Features
  • The hopper and mixing blades are made entirely of stainless steel, which facilitates cleaning and ensures they are completely environmentally friendly.
  • Interlocking safety guards ensure the safety of both operators and the machine;
  • Constructed from thick materials, it is robust and durable;
  • It can produce a homogeneous mixture in a short time with low energy consumption and high efficiency;
  • An automatic stop device adjustable between 0 and 15 minutes.
